How to prepare for a job interview at Demob Job Ltd
✨Know Your Technical Stuff
Brush up on your electrical engineering principles and maintenance practices. Be ready to discuss specific systems you've worked on, as well as any troubleshooting techniques you’ve used in the past.
✨Showcase Your Problem-Solving Skills
Prepare examples of how you've tackled maintenance issues in previous roles.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ers and highlight your critical thinking abilities.
✨Understand the Company Culture
Research the company’s values and work environment. Being able to articulate why you want to work there and how you fit into their culture can set you apart from other candidates.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the role and the team. This shows your genuine interest in the position and helps you gauge if it’s the right fit for you too.
